About YouYou enjoy physical, hands-on work and take pride in maintaining a clean, safe, and organized environment. A large portion of this role involves cleaning horse stalls, moving hay and bedding, pushing wheelbarrows, stocking supplies, and performing general barn upkeep. This role involves working outdoors in the Texas heat and other weather conditions.
This is not a horse riding, training, or primary horse-handling position. While you will work around horses and other large animals, the primary focus of the role is supporting daily barn operations and maintaining a clean, safe facility.

- Clean and maintain horse stalls, pens, and animal housing areas
- Remove manure, replace bedding, and maintain sanitary conditions throughout the facility
- Move hay, feed, bedding, and other supplies throughout the hospital and barn areas
- Stock and organize feed rooms, supply areas, and treatment spaces
- Perform general barn and facility cleaning, including aisles, treatment areas, storage areas, and common spaces
- Maintain grounds and outdoor work areas to promote a safe environment
- Feed, water, and assist with the daily care of hospitalized equine and bovine patients
- Monitor animals and communicate concerns regarding behavior, appetite, or condition to veterinary staff
- Operate basic hand tools, equipment, wheelbarrows, and cleaning tools safely
- Assist with routine facility upkeep and support hospital operations as needed
- Stock and manage inventory of feed, bedding, and medical supplies
